The PI's Bronislaw Czarnocha and Vrunda Prabhu, will conduct two year-long cycles ofteaching experiments to introduce the intuition of "indivisibles" into calculus instruction andintegrate it with standard ways of instructing via Riemann construction. They plan to studyclosely the conceptual and computational development of students who receive this instruction. ItAs part of this project, the PI's will investigate:(1) What is the process of transformation and development of the intuition of lines (theindivisibles) into a precise, mathematical concept?(2) Does the introduction of the W-C construction based on indivisibles, the interplay of thatconstruction with the standard Riemann construction, and the instruction that integrates both,strengthen students' understanding of the concept of the definite integral?In the proposed project, they will conduct and coordinate Calculus instruction at sixinstitutions, assess students' performance via tests, essays and clinical interviews, collect dataresulting from the different assessment and analyze the data in preparation for a refinement of theteaching strategy. As a general framework they will adopt Vygotsky's theory with its emphasison the cognitive processes in the zone of proximal development, which dictates importantconsequences on the instruction and assessment. Students will be guided by the activities of theclass to enable them to experience the process of mathematical thinking and to reveal its contentto the teacher. The role of the instructor will be to provide systematization of their spontaneousdevelopment grounded in the precise mathematical understanding of the concept in question. Thedirections their spontaneous thought processes take, will be under investigation during the course.The project is a balance between various aspects: (1) the natural intuition of the learner vs.the academic instruction, (2) computational mastery vs. conceptual understanding, (3) teachingand research.
